Ralley Wheels
Did 72 Blazers come from the factory with ralley wheels?
|
Re: Ralley Wheels
No the GM ralley wheels were not on GM trucks until after 75 or so. But I think they look right at home on the earlier trucks.
|
Re: Ralley Wheels
nope, ralley wheels didn't start till mid 70's ish
|
Re: Ralley Wheels
what wheels would have come on my 72 k5??
I thought that the ralleys were period correct. |
Re: Ralley Wheels
Regular old steel wheels with hubcaps was the only option back then.
Either had full hubcaps or dog dish hubcaps. |
